Purification Methods

Crystallise 4-pyridone from H2O or wet CHCl3 as the monohydrate. It loses H2O on drying in vacuo over H2SO4. Store it over KOH because it is hygroscopic.[Beilstein 21 III/IV 446, 21/7 V 152.]

Definition

ChEBI: A monohydroxypyridine that is pyridine in which the hydrogen at position 4 has been replaced by a hydroxy group.
